Boyd Elementary School is an elementary school in Boyd, TX, in the Boyd ISD school district. As of the 2023-2024 school year, it had 484 students. 41.5% of students were considered at risk of dropping out of school. 7.2% of students were enrolled in bilingual and English language learning programs.
The school received an accountability rating of None for the 2023-2024 school year.
As of the 2023-2024 school year, an average teacher's salary was $55,872, which is $6,602 less than the state average. On average, teachers had 11.9 years of experience.

Students in Boyd Elementary School are part of the Texas Education Agency’s Region 11. Students who started eighth grade in 2011 in this region had a college graduation rate of 22.4 percent. View a more comprehensive breakdown of the higher education outcomes in Region 11.

The overall grades are based on three categories: student achievement (how well students perform academically), school progress (how well students perform over time and compared to students in similar schools) and closing the gaps (how well schools are boosting performance for subgroups such as students with special needs).
